Corazón Cabo Resort & Spa has announced the appointment of Paris Cendejas as its new Director of Marketing, signaling a strategic push to enhance the resort’s global visibility and brand presence. In his new role, Cendejas will oversee all marketing and commercial initiatives, aiming to amplify the resort’s signature experiences and extend its reach across key international and domestic markets.
Bringing over 15 years of marketing leadership across premier hospitality brands, Cendejas is recognized for his data-driven, creative approach to brand development and guest engagement. Fluent in English and Spanish, he holds certifications in digital marketing, revenue management, and B2B prospecting.
"Paris brings an outstanding combination of strategic vision, creative energy, and market expertise across both luxury resort and destination marketing," said Carlos Blanco, General Manager of Corazón Cabo Resort & Spa. "We’re excited to welcome him to the team as we continue to grow Corazón Cabo’s reputation as a leading destination for both leisure travelers and groups of all sizes, from corporate gatherings to unforgettable weddings."
Cendejas previously served as the marketing lead for five business units under the Mundo Cuervo portfolio in Tequila, Jalisco, where he drove luxury campaigns and led digital transformation initiatives for properties such as Hotel Solar de las Ánimas and the Tren José Cuervo Express. His background also includes senior roles at Tesoro Ixtapa, Casa del Mar Boutique, Vivo Resorts, and Riu Hotels & Resorts.
At Corazón Cabo, Cendejas will be instrumental in highlighting the resort’s standout amenities, including Rooftop 360—the tallest rooftop bar in Cabo San Lucas—and over 45,000 square feet of flexible event space designed for both large-scale events and intimate gatherings.
“I’m honored to join Corazón Cabo and help shape the next chapter of its brand journey,” said Cendejas. “This resort embodies the spirit of Baja with luxury, vibrancy, and unforgettable experiences—and I look forward to spearheading campaigns and programs that inspire travelers from around the world to make it their destination of choice.”
Corazón Cabo Resort & Spa continues to position itself as a top-tier destination for travelers seeking luxury, innovation, and immersive experiences in one of Mexico’s most iconic coastal cities.
